Real estate & living comparison
| Jabalpur | Mainz | |
|---|---|---|
| Price per Square Meter to Buy Apartment Outside of Centre | 730.27 USD | 5234.53 USD |
| 1 Bedroom Apartment Outside of City Centre | 75.99 USD | 778.6 USD |
| 3 Bedroom Apartment Outside of City Centre | 199.01 USD | 1273.96 USD |
| Average Monthly Net Salary (After Tax) | 303.64 USD | 3249.04 USD |
| GDP Growth Rate: | 8.15 USD | 0.27 USD |
| Monthly Public Transport Pass (Regular Price) | 3.26 USD | 67.79 USD |
| Basic Utilities for 85 m2 Apartment (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water, Garbage) | 56.08 USD | 345.11 USD |
| Population | 1,267,564 | 222,889 |
